Dr. Katie McKeown focuses on low-income and first-generation college student access as well as STEM education access. She is currently working in these areas as co-founder/board member of Duke First, founder/director of Packs of Hope, 501(c)(3), and a mentor in different spaces focused on education access. Dr. McKeown graduated with a Ph.D. and Masters in Mathematics from the University of Alabama, researching precalculus students and their use of academic resources. Dr. McKeown graduated from Duke University in 2019 with an A.B. in Mathematics alongside minors in Earth and Ocean Sciences and Education, as well as her Secondary Teaching Certification. She is excited to join the e4usa family, officially, as the Business Operations Coordinator after four years of supporting different e4usa projects.
